Tangible Interfaces

Tangible interfaces beyond screens for application development

From GUIs to tangible interfaces:

From the early days of Graphical User Interfaces (GUIs) to the touchscreen revolution, user interaction has evolved significantly. The quest for richer experiences has led us to tangible interfaces, breaking free from traditional input devices and introducing new dimensions to engaging with digital content. 

The power of the physical:

Tangible interfaces liberate us from the confines of traditional input devices. Gesture-based inputs and haptic feedback enhance sensory experiences while integrating physical objects, such as smart devices and IoT, blurring the lines between the digital and physical worlds. 

Bridging worlds with AR and MR:

The marriage of Augmented Reality (AR) and Mixed Reality (MR) technologies ushers in a new era, blurring the lines between the real and the virtual. Tangible AR interfaces enhance user experiences and find applications in healthcare, education, and beyond. 

Spatial computing and Brain-computer interfaces:

Looking ahead, emerging technologies like Spatial Computing and Brain-Computer Interfaces promise to shape the future of tangible interfaces. Real-time collaboration in physical spaces and tangible coding environments hint at a future where developers craft applications in a three-dimensional, collaborative world. 

Ethical implications and responsible design:

In this brave new world of tangible interfaces, we must tread carefully. Addressing privacy concerns, ensuring inclusivity, and empowering users through ethical design practices are paramount. Prioritizing responsible development is crucial to avoid unintentional pitfalls. 

Cultural and societal impact:

Beyond the technical facets, tangible interfaces wield significant cultural and societal impact. They play a pivotal role in cultural preservation and redefine social interactions in gaming, social media, and communication. 

DIY and maker culture:

Empowering developers and users alike, the rise of tangible interfaces aligns with the ethos of DIY and Maker Culture. Open-source projects, community collaboration, and user-generated content pave the way for a more democratized and customizable digital landscape. 

  • Open-source kits: DIY enthusiasts create open-source kits for building tangible interfaces, making innovation accessible to everyone.  
  • User-friendly hardware: Tangible interfaces often have customizable parts, letting users experiment and adapt them to their needs.  
  • Collaborative prototyping: Makers collaborate on projects, sharing ideas and resources to develop new tangible interfaces. 

Psychological impact:

Beyond tangible benefits, there’s a psychological impact to consider. Tangible interfaces enhance cognitive engagement, improve memory recall, and foster emotional connections to digital spaces. They find applications in entertainment, rehabilitation, and therapeutic contexts. 

  • Memory boost: Physical interactions in interfaces, like moving objects, help people remember things better.   
  • Emotional therapy: Tangible interfaces are used in treatment, making rehab more engaging and emotionally supportive  
  • Smart learning: Tangible tools in education make learning fun and improve memory, getting students more involved 

Interactive exhibitions and tangible interface festivals:

Public engagement catalyzes innovation through interactive exhibits and tangible interface festivals. These events showcase the latest technologies and invite the community to actively participate in shaping the future of interaction. 

  • Hands-on tech expos: Tech events let people build tangible interfaces, giving developers valuable feedback.  
  • Hackathons for creativity: Tangible interface hackathons bring people together to create new solutions collaboratively.  
  • Inclusive challenges: Some festivals focus on creating interfaces for everyone, promoting accessibility and diversity. 

Challenges and considerations

Technological barriers: 

  • Overcoming the complexity of integrating tangible elements with digital systems. 
  • Meeting the need for sophisticated sensors, advanced algorithms, and seamless connectivity. 
  • Balancing innovation with practicality in pushing technological boundaries. 

Hardware limitations: 

  • Addressing the requirement for robust and durable physical components. 
  • Tackling integration challenges with sensors, actuators, and diverse tangible forms. 
  • Ensuring adaptability and scalability in hardware design for various tangible interactions. 

Inclusive user experience: 

  • Ensuring accessibility for users with diverse physical abilities and tech familiarity. 
  • Incorporating user testing, feedback loops, and iterative design for an inclusive interface. 
  • Prioritizing universal design principles to accommodate a broad user base. 

Balancing technological boundaries: 

  • Temper enthusiasm for pushing technological boundaries with practical considerations. 
  • Assessing real-world applicability to avoid unnecessary complexity. 
  • Focusing on user value and practicality to enhance the overall user experience. 

Prioritizing accessibility for all: 

  • Addressing physical accessibility issues and providing alternative interaction methods. 
  • Considering the broader societal impact of tangible interfaces. 
  • Integrating universal design principles from the outset to enhance accessibility.
